Advice for beginners to learn 8 tips for Linux systems

Source: Internet
Author: User

newcomers or small partners who are about to enter the pit, often QQ Group or in Linux The Forum asked some questions, but most of them were very basic. For example, how to assign the user group to add, copy the entire file to another directory, partition the disk properly, or even configure IP, these problems are not very difficult, as long as you understand the foundation of Linux , it is easy to solve the problem. And there are some non-partners he often on a come up to directly engage in Web site, open sshd Services,FTP Services, there is no idea to first understand Linux the basis. You don't even walk, you can't run.

First: Learn using the Linux command

Today the desktop of Linux is developing quickly, but the command line is still the most effective and convenient in the system. The essence of Linux is the proficiency of commands, regardless of the level of the development of the graphical interface is not the truth,Linux commands have many powerful features: from simple disk operations, file access, To the complex multimedia image and the production of streaming media files, you can complete a very complex operation, if the same operation with the graphical interface tools to complete, I am afraid to spend a lot more time.

however different versions of The number of Linux commands is not the same, they are more important and most frequently used commands, according to their role in the system is divided into several parts introduced to you, through the learning of these basic commands we can further understand the Linux system:

Installation and Login commands:login, shutdown, halt, reboot , Mount,umount ,chsh

file processing command: file,  mkdir  grep dd  find ,  MV&NBSP, , ls  diff  cat ,  ln

System Management Related commands:df, top, free, quota , Groupadd kill, crontab, tar, last

Network operation command:Ifconfig,IP,Ping,netstat,telnet,FTP,Route,rlogin rcp,Finger,Mail,nslookup

system Security Related commands: passwd ,su, umask ,chgrp, chmod,chown,chattr,sudo, pswho

Second: Select a book books or tutorials that suit you

reference books are very important for learning, and a wrong concept of the reference book will make the whole novice astray. About the Linux book can say a lot of not come over, choose suitable for their own on the line, must persist to see, do not notwith two days, I choose is "Linux should learn" this book, Write the easy-to-digest can also be viewed online (do not spend money to buy), so online on the book's reputation is very good, but choose the best for their own, do not conform.

Third: Choose a Linux distribution that works for you

There are currently more than 100 global Linux Distributions, released by individuals, loosely organized teams, business organizations and volunteer organizations, can also find more than 10 common versions in the country. How to choose according to your needs and capabilities,RHEL ,Centos and Debian Linux is the ideal choice for network administrators, domestic enterprises use RHEL,thecentos System is the most, the author is still more recommended to use Centos .

Fourth: develop a habit of working under the command line

be sure to develop the habit of working under the command line, Linux Desktop for the system is an application, from the efficiency and ease of use is not the original Shell(CLI) to be useful, although at the command line to learn at the beginning of slow progress, But with familiarity, the future of learning will grow exponentially. From the network administrator, the command line is actually the rule, it is always effective, but also flexible. When you click on the desktop icon, it is only the conversion of your click into the command, if you only will point to the desktop, then you are not a qualified Linux network administrator.

Fifth: Diligent hands-on experiments.

to enhance yourLinuxskills, only through the can practice hard study to achieve. So, find a computer, install aLinuxrelease, then go to the wonderfulLinuxWorld, believe in your ownLinuxAbility is bound to be great . In addition, the human brain is not like a computer's hard disk, unless the hard drive is broken or the data is erased, otherwise the stored data will be stored in the hard disk forever and immediately, in the human memory curve, you have to continue to repeat the practice will be a thing remember more familiar;LinuxAlso, if you can not learn often, learn the back will forget the front, theLinuxcommand familiarity can begin to build a smallLinuxNetwork, this is the best way to learn, the method of building a website can refer to:http://www.linuxprobe.com/chapter-10.html. Linuxis synonymous with the Internet,LinuxThe Network service is very powerful, whether it is a mail server,Webservers,DNSservers, etc. can be built. If you have problems, don't wait for others to solve your problems.

Sixth: Learn to get help from others

Unlike business systems, each Linux releases have a short technical support time, which is often not enough for Linux beginners. In fact, when you install a complete Linux system which already contains a powerful help, just maybe you have not found and used their skills.

1.  mainstream linux faq ), From system installation to system security Detailed documentation for people of different levels, After reading the document carefully 40% , Span style= "font-family: the song Body;" The rest of the 60% linux Span style= "font-family: the song Body;" > So it's time to learn this technical book to solve the .

2. access to classic reference books and Howto, especially Howto is the world's tens of thousands of Linux,Unix The experience of practitioners is of great reference value and can be solved by Howto .

Seventh: Find answers in the Linux community

If the above measures do not solve the problem, then you need to The Linux community has helped. Linux users are generally professionals, they have a good computer background and are willing to assist others,Linux Experts have a cultural spirit to encourage beginners. How to get help in the Linux Community, it is necessary to explain that you have thoughtful thinking, prepare your questions, don't ask questions hastily, or you will get a hasty answer or no answer at all. The more you show the effort to solve the problem before you ask for help, the more substantial help you can get. It is best to search the forum for the article you need, so you can get more results.

Eighth: abandon Windows thinking

The philosophical thinking of Windows and Linux Systems is completely different, please do not follow the WINDOSW thought to learn Linux, Then you will go to another mistake. Learn Linux Best installed English version of the system to learn, such as the use of Chinese environment, there may be some problems, not conducive to learning.

I think everyone is good at how to learn Linux has a better idea, I believe those Linux Beginners Read this article, can clear their own learning methods, have their own set of learning ideas, can be in the Linux On the road to go more long!

Advice for beginners to learn 8 tips for Linux systems

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.